Transaction 79c68bb9808a3e077d50f70bd539e3e3b168c984025ab5c968d2c158cd521a60
1 Input
1 Output
-
79c68bb9808a3e077d50f70bd539e3e3b168c984025ab5c968d2c158cd521a60:0
- value
- 37585
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dafd4ccabaca54dd1f53541027d6974afa29d217 OP_EQUAL
- address
- 3MevfxEb8JqrGBk3oodAz7g43gkVKntaqp